B1691

DTC B1691 indicates the Airbag Control Module (ACM) detects a verification failure of its internally stored factory-encrypted data or security authentication key — Seal U

Safety System

DTC B1691 indicates the Airbag Control Module (ACM) detects a verification failure of its internally stored factory-encrypted data or security authentication key.

This fault involves the SRS security authentication mechanism.

The module triggers this fault when its stored factory configuration data, encryption key, or anti-theft authentication information does not match the reference data stored in the VCU/BCM.

Common causes include: installing a non-genuine airbag module without online matching, corrupted internal EEPROM data, vehicle power system anomalies causing encrypted data loss, or failing to complete the module matching procedure correctly during production or repair.

This safety-related fault causes the airbag system to enter a degraded mode and may limit normal airbag deployment.

3
Cases Logged
5
Causes
  • 1Replacing the Airbag Control Module (ACM) with a non-genuine part or failing to match the ACM online causes an encryption key mismatch with the vehicle.
  • 2Electromagnetic interference, static electricity, or a hardware fault corrupted the factory configuration data or encryption key stored in the airbag module.
  • 3Severe vehicle battery discharge, improper jump-starting, or power supply system voltage fluctuations resulting in module data loss.
  • 4Using non-dedicated diagnostic equipment to operate the SRS system during repairs, inadvertently triggering factory mode or overwriting encrypted data.
  • 5Software upgrade failure or module hardware fault (such as EEPROM damage) causes security authentication algorithm verification failure.
  • 1
    Use the BYD VDS diagnostic tool to read the complete fault codes and freeze frame data. Confirm whether B1691 is a current fault and record the vehicle status when the fault occurred.
  • 2
    Check the airbag control module (ACM) power supply (constant B+, ignition IG1), ground, and CAN-H/CAN-L circuit connections. Measure the supply voltage to confirm it is within 12V ± 0.5V, and verify the ground resistance is less than 1Ω.
  • 3
    Perform the 'SRS system online matching' or 'factory encryption reset' procedure. Verify and rewrite the module encryption data via the official BYD server to match the module with the vehicle VIN and anti-theft system.
  • 4
    If online matching fails, verify the module part number, hardware version, and software version match the vehicle configuration. If necessary, replace with a new genuine ACM and repeat the matching procedure.
  • 5
    After matching, clear the fault code and perform the 'SRS system self-check'. Confirm the airbag warning light turns off normally. Perform a battery disconnect test and a road test to verify the fault does not recur.
BYD DTC AI Analysis

Replaced SRS module with salvaged unit on accident-damaged vehicle, now showing B1691.

After a front-end collision, a workshop installed a used airbag control module (ACM) from the same model into a 2021 BYD Tang. The airbag warning light remained on. VDS diagnosis retrieved DTC B1691 (Factory Encryption), which would not clear. Inspection revealed the salvaged module had not been unbound. The workshop then fitted a new genuine ACM, performed online matching and immobiliser authentication via VDS, cleared the DTC, and restored normal airbag system function.
BYD DTC AI Analysis

Extended stationary period caused battery discharge, resulting in abnormal SRS data

A 2019 BYD Yuan EV sat for about 3 months, causing severe battery discharge (voltage below 5V). After jump-starting, the instrument cluster displayed "Check SRS System". The scanner retrieved DTC B1691 and low-voltage history records. Charged the battery, replaced the aging battery, and used VDS to perform "SRS System Initialization" and "Clear History Faults". The DTC cleared. Low voltage caused a temporary module data anomaly.
BYD DTC AI Analysis

Software upgrade interrupted, causing encryption verification failure

A 2020 BYD Qin SRS control module software update failed when the diagnostic tool lost connection mid-process. After reconnecting, the instrument cluster displayed the airbag warning light and stored DTC B1691. Reflashing the software had no effect. Using the VDS, the technician executed the 'Factory Encryption Reset' special function and then re-performed the module-to-vehicle identity authentication and data synchronisation, which cleared the fault.
Data confidence: Official This information is for reference only. Always consult a qualified technician for diagnosis and repair. Do not attempt high-voltage system repairs yourself.